La-Z-Boy Delano Big & Tall Executive Office Chair, Black with Mahogany Finish

If you're seeking a sophisticated and robust office chair, the La-Z-Boy Delano Big & Tall Executive Office Chair might be your ideal choice, especially for those who require extra support and comfort. This chair offers high back ergonomic lumbar support and is upholstered in durable bonded chestnut brown leather with a mahogany wood finish. Its big and tall design can accommodate users up to 350 pounds. With fully adjustable height, recline, and tilt settings, the memory foam cushioning contours to your body, ensuring premium comfort. Although assembly requires two people, its sturdy components and stylish design make it a worthwhile investment.

DUMOS Criss Cross Chair, Adjustable Armless Office Desk Seat

The DUMOS Criss Cross Chair is perfect for those seeking a modern, versatile seating solution for various activities. You'll appreciate its armless, height-adjustable design, which allows for easy movement and comfort. The chair features a channel-tufted, cushioned seat with high-density foam, offering excellent support for relaxed or cross-legged sitting. Its U-shaped structure and contoured backrest promote a healthy spine alignment.

With a 360-degree swivel and adjustable tilt, it meets both work and leisure needs. Assembly's a breeze, taking just 10-15 minutes. Although some users note sharp leg corners, it's highly rated for comfort and ease of use.

ECOTOUGE Tufted Faux Leather Office Chair

Looking for a blend of modern charm and antique elegance in your office setup? The ECOTOUGE Tufted Faux Leather Office Chair offers just that. Its wingback design and tufted back with rivet detailing give it a distinctive character. Crafted from high-intensity PU fabric and supported by solid wood feet, this chair promises durability and style. You'll appreciate the ergonomic features, including adjustable height and rocking function. With a weight capacity of 333 pounds, it's built for comfort and strength. Customers love its style and comfort, although assembly instructions could be clearer. Overall, it's a top choice for a stylish home office.

Material Quality and Durability

Choosing the right desk chair hinges on material quality and durability, two essential factors that define long-term satisfaction. Opt for high-quality leather to guarantee both a premium look and lasting durability. Solid wood components not only enhance the chair's elegance but also provide superior structural integrity, vital for daily use. Consider upholstery made from high-intensity fabrics or faux leather that resist wear while keeping a stylish appearance.

When evaluating your chair, prioritize those with solid wood frames, as they usually offer greater longevity compared to cheaper materials. Verify that the chair's gas lift mechanism and hardware are certified, like with BIFMA standards, to guarantee safety and durability. Quality stitching and robust construction further enhance the chair's resilience and aesthetic appeal, making it a worthwhile investment.

Ergonomic Comfort Features

Although aesthetics and materials are important, ergonomic comfort features should be a top priority when selecting a leather and wood desk chair. You'll want adjustable height, recline, and tilt settings to suit your body type and guarantee comfort during long hours. Lumbar support, like contoured back panels, is essential for maintaining proper spinal alignment and preventing back pain. Memory foam cushioning is a must, as it conforms to your body, providing personalized support. A seat width of at least 21-3/4 inches offers more comfort if you have a larger frame, allowing for natural seating positions. Don't forget features like 360-degree swivel and adjustable armrests, which can enhance mobility and ease the shift between tasks, reducing strain.

Weight Capacity and Support

When selecting a leather and wood desk chair, it's essential to take into account the weight capacity and support to guarantee comfort and safety. Most chairs support weights ranging from 250 to 350 pounds, so verify your choice matches your needs. A chair's support depends on its construction; chairs with metal frames and solid wood bases offer better support for heavier users. Ergonomic features like lumbar support and adjustable height enhance comfort and posture, particularly if you're near the chair's weight limit. Check user reviews for insights on durability and support. Opt for chairs that meet industry standards like BIFMA testing, ensuring they withstand typical office stresses. This way, you select a chair that's both stylish and resilient.

Adjustability and Functionality

After confirming your leather and wood desk chair is easy to assemble and maintain, turn your attention to its adjustability and functionality. Opt for chairs with fully adjustable height, recline, and tilt settings. This guarantees comfort for various body types and sitting preferences, especially during long hours of work. An adjustable height range is essential for proper desk alignment and promoting ergonomic posture. Look for chairs offering a tilt range of 90-120 degrees, which provides a relaxed seating option, reducing strain on your back and legs. Consider features like 360-degree swivel capability to enhance mobility and accessibility without straining. Finally, verify the chair includes memory foam or high-density foam cushioning for targeted support and comfort during extended use.
